Habitat Module Acoustic Privacy Planner

Lay out a space station corridor in 3D and see, in real decibels, whether a crew sleep pod stays quiet enough. Sound pressure spreads outward from noisy equipment — pumps, fans, the exercise treadmill — following an inverse-square law, and every partition it crosses removes a further fixed amount set by the wall's transmission loss. Move the sleep pod, add bulkheads, and switch materials to watch the sound-pressure wavefront animate down the corridor and the live SPL readout cross NASA's 50 dB sleep-quarters guidance.
